4Pulsar Black Chronograph  Apr 30, 2011 By Mike5468
I received the Pulsar Black Chronograph from Shnoop.com yesterday. Everything seems to be fine, the watch and chronograph work properly, for only $50 it is a GREAT DEAL. One thing I've noticed a few times in reviews are people complaining about how their watches stopped after a couple week, couple of months etc, but what you probably don't realize is that the watch may have been running in "stock" for a year or more, thus draining the battery. I give this watch 4 stars out of 5. It seems to be a delicate watch for fashion/dress occasions. Not something you want to sweat into while working out. It doesn't seem like a watch that could take a "beating" so to speak, but if you're light on it, the watch seems like it would work for years.

2Nice looking - poor performing  Aug 23, 2009 By Stephen Dechert
I owned this watch for a few months and loved it. I received many comments on the color, which is why I bought it. However, upon flying to a different time zone, I struggled to re-set the time. After multiple attempts, I finally got it to set. When I returned home, I tried to re-set the watch again and the gears stripped out. Now the watch is permanently set to Central Time and the date is a day off. I can't change either and it will cost me more to fix it than I originally paid for it.
